Step 1: Understanding AI in Architecture

  • Definition of AI in Architecture: AI refers to the use of algorithms and machine learning to assist in design processes, project management, and decision-making in architecture.
  • Benefits:
    • Enhances design accuracy and efficiency.
    • Automates repetitive tasks, allowing architects to focus on creativity.
    • Improves project timelines and cost management through predictive analytics.

Step 2: Exploring AI Tools and Technologies

  • Familiarize yourself with various AI tools that can be utilized in architectural design:
    • Generative Design Software: Programs like Autodesk's Generative Design allow architects to input parameters and generate multiple design options automatically.
    • Building Information Modeling (BIM): Tools like Revit integrate AI to optimize building designs, manage energy consumption, and streamline construction processes.
    • Virtual Reality (VR) and Augmented Reality (AR): These technologies enable immersive design experiences, allowing clients to visualize spaces before they are built.

Step 4: Overcoming Challenges

  • Common Pitfalls:
    • Relying too heavily on AI without human oversight can lead to designs that lack creativity or context.
    • Ensure that all stakeholders are trained to use AI tools effectively.
  • Strategies to Mitigate Risks:
    • Maintain a balance between automated processes and human input.
    • Regularly update skills and knowledge about emerging AI technologies.
